Output ae07ec1bbb679e995644e3f98961452f45490e9abb7ab2449ee6aa9e350c25f5:51

value
59396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f19ff2084b7a71d38a8e940f522d345a42a081c0 OP_EQUAL
address
3PicNyizzcgjRqty1tnQcEvkmfv3JgzypJ
transaction
ae07ec1bbb679e995644e3f98961452f45490e9abb7ab2449ee6aa9e350c25f5
confirmations
184857
spent
true